The Swedish esports organization Ninjas in Pyjamas is actively working on refining its Counter-Strike 2 roster in a bid to reclaim its position among the elite in competitive gaming. To facilitate this goal, the team has implemented several significant adjustments, which include sidelining and releasing a few members while promoting others from its academy squad.

Specifically, Alejandro Masanet has been put on the bench, and Fredrik Junbrant has been let go. In their place, Gareth Ries and Daniel Kogan have been elevated from the academy lineup to join the main roster.

The logic driving these changes is based on the organization's confidence in the NIP Academy initiative and its potential to bolster the primary team effectively. According to team representatives, this is an ongoing journey, and they are eager to witness the results of their dedicated practice and hard work in the future. They also express gratitude for the unwavering support from their fans, emphasizing that their success is a collective effort.
